Following a return to drawing, this series of collages was made as an immediate response to events in Dixon’s life, both personal and political. Though collage Dixon found a way to make work that was playful and immediate, made in their living room, in front of the TV. Using around 80 ‘lads’ magazines sourced from eBay and Vinted, the collages are humorous inversions of gender, sport, automotive culture and pornography.
